The Por Kwan brand Minced Crab in Spices comes packed with flavors; you don't need to add anything else if you're cooking a small amount of rice and vegetables. Since I cook quite a bit of rice, here are the additional ingredients I used: Three crab fish sauce, organic sugar, and black peppers. I used sesame oil in the beginning to fry the garlic, but vegetable oil would be fine. I had to rewatch the video. Please let me know if you have any questions. Regards, Lee

Below is the information for this cooking video. Ingredients: A can of minced crab meat, 4-5 cloves of garlic, 1 small (1 lb) bag of mixed vegetables (carrot, corn, and peas), 2 tbs of sesame oil, 2 eggs, 2 tbs vegetable oil. Cooking Instruction: Heat the pan with sesame oil, put in chopped garlic, fry to a golden brown, add vegetables, and steamed rice. Stir and add 1 tbs soy sauce, 1 tbs sugar, a dash of black peppers, 1 tsp fish sauce. Keep stirring gently for a couple of minutes. Once the fried rice is done, set it aside. Heat a clean pan, add the vegetable oil, crack 2 eggs and cook it scramble style. Set it aside with the fried rice. Heat a clean pan, cook the minced crab on medium-high heat. When it starts to bubble, add the fried rice and scrambled eggs. Stir the fried rice and minced crab meat. Keep tossing for 4-5 minutes, taste your cooking, and plate it. Thanks! Lee
